Font Size: a A A

Research On Rectangular Optimal Layout Algorithm And System Implementation

Posted on:2009-05-13Degree:MasterType:Thesis
Country:ChinaCandidate:X D ZhaoFull Text:PDF
GTID:2178360272963194Subject:Vehicle Engineering
Abstract/Summary:PDF Full Text Request
The problem of rectangular layout is to put various different sizes rectangular objects into stock sheets, how to make the ratio of material highly under the condition of no interference and not beyond the boundary [1]. It is extensively applied into the glass, steel plate, timber, leather etc. From mathematics calculation complexity theory, the problem whose computation is the most complex in theory belongs to the NP complete problem. The solution of the valid polynomial time calculate way can't find out by now. A good packing scheme can not only save raw material and reduce production cost, but also bring economic benefit for and enhance the competitiveness of enterprises. Therefore, research on the problem of optimal layout for rectangular part is very important in theory and applications.In this paper, the features of problem are studied and its mathematics model is established. Some kind of optimal algorithms and common layout algorithms for the optimal layout of rectangular part are introduced. Under certain constraints, genetic algorithm is applied into the optimal layout of rectangular part. The results of instances are compared each other and analyzed in detail.Firstly, introduce the mathematics model of the optimal layout of rectangular part and some kind of common layout algorithms, such as the surplus rectangular to match algorithm, bottom-left algorithm,'downstairs'algorithm, on the basis of the lowest horizontal line-search algorithm. We compare these algorithms.Secondly, introduced the rectangular parts'cutting draft of the large-scale production, such as guillotine; lay the same rectangular object together in order to improve efficiency; there is the guarantee of the safe distance while process.Then introduce the basic theory of genetic algorithm. The genetic algorithm is used to solve the problem of rectangular part optimal layout. In the meantime, the coding method, fitness function definition, GA operator and some key parameters are given. The result is analyzed and compared with each other through examples.Finally, according to above theory, we develop system of rectangular object optimal layout with VB.NET, including user login, the management of parts and stock sheets and optimal layout.The paper applied genetic algorithm and on the basis of the lowest horizontal line-search algorithm into rectangular object optimal layout. The experimental results satisfy craft requirement of guillotine and laying the same rectangular object together, and the ratio of using of stock sheets is about 94 percents. It can be used in practice.
Keywords/Search Tags:rectangular optimal layout, layout system, genetic algorithm, genetic operator, guillotine
PDF Full Text Request
Related items